"The Mountain School-Teacher" by Melville Davisson Post offers a captivating glimpse into rural life and the challenges and triumphs of education in a bygone era. These short stories, set against the backdrop of the countryside, explore themes of community, resilience, and the enduring power of the human spirit.
As a work of fiction, this collection provides a window into the world of the Westerns genre, with touches of humor woven throughout. Experience the charm and simplicity of a time when the school-teacher held a central role in shaping the lives of those in their community. Prepared for republication, this edition allows readers to rediscover a classic voice and a timeless narrative that continues to resonate.
